The average bus between Killaloe and Adare takes 1h 32m and the fastest bus takes 1h 3m. The bus service runs several times per day from Killaloe to Adare.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run 5 times a day between Killaloe and Adare. The earliest departure is at 7:19 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Killaloe is at 7:25 PM which arrives into Adare at 9:25 PM. All services require a transfer at William Street and take an average of 1h 32m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Killaloe to Adare. However, there are services departing from Killaloe station and arriving at Adare station via William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 32m.
Killaloe to Adare bus services, operated by Bus Éireann, depart from Killaloe station.
Killaloe to Adare bus services, operated by Bus Éireann, arrive at Adare station.
The distance between Killaloe and Adare is 36 km. The road distance is 43 km.
